KEYS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

656 of the 4,956 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Keysight (KEYS)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$16.2B — down 4.1% from $16.9B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 92 funds closed out of KEYS and 82 opened new positions — a net loss of 10 holders — while 244 trimmed existing stakes and 235 added.

The largest buyer was Swedbank, adding an estimated $149M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$224M.
